Thanks & RegardsLVM snapshot is a general purpose solution that was not designed with Oracle database in mind. It can be used, for example, to quickly create a snapshot prior to a system upgrade, then if you are satisfied with the result, you would delete the snaphot.
There is probably a common misconception. LVM snapshots, like all COW snapshosts that I'm aware off, allow to create a backup of a live filesystem while changes are written to the snapshot volume. Hence it's called "copy on write", or copy on change if you want. This is necessary for system integrity to make a complete backup of all data in a LVM volume at a certain point in time and to allow changes happening while the filesystem backup is taking place. A snapshot is no substitute for a disaster recovery backup in case you loose your storage media. A snapshot only takes seconds, and initially does not copy or backup any data, unless data changes. It is therefore important to delete the snapshot if no longer required, in order to prevent duplication of data and restore file system performance.
If snapshot or COW technololgy suits your purpose, you will actually want to look into BTRFS filesystem, which is more modern, employs the idea of subvolumes and is much more efficient that LVM. -

u can retry configuration this database with enterprise manager later by manually running c:\ora\product\10.2.0\db_1\bin\emcaWindows and Unix (in general) are different from the point of view that on windows platforms no relink operations are required, since the install media has the already compiled and linked executables and dll's required. On the unix like platforms, the story is different, relinking is required to create executables, since the install media has the object files. Makefiles are included to perform the relink operation and the relinking is nothing else but recreate executable images. If you were required to relink, probably it's because during install phase something went wrong and there were no relinked executables that made your working environment fail.
In this case, on the windows platform, this problem looks like a configuration issue.

Because of bugs in efibootmgr and/or EFI implementations, efibootmgr doesn't always work. Using bcfg from an EFI shell or bcdedit in Windows can be more effective on some systems. That said, if efibootmgr worked for you before, I'm not sure why it would stop working, or why an existing entry might disappear. (Some EFIs do delete entries that they detect are no longer valid. This shouldn't have happened with a whole-disk dd copy, but if you duplicated the partition table and then used dd to copy partitions, it might well have happened to you. I suppose it's conceivable that the firmware detected the change from one physical disk to another, too, and deleted the original entry because of that change.)
